Carpet patching services involve repairing damaged areas of a carpet by removing the affected section and replacing it with a piece of matching material. This process typically requires cutting out the worn or stained portion and fitting a new patch that blends seamlessly with the existing carpet. Skilled service providers use precise techniques to ensure the repair is discreet, restoring the appearance of the carpet without the need for full replacement. Carpet patching is an effective solution for addressing localized damage caused by spills, burns, pet accidents, or wear and tear over time.

This service helps resolve common problems such as unsightly stains, frayed edges, or small holes that can detract from the overall look of a room. It is especially useful when damage is confined to a small area, allowing property owners to avoid the expense and effort of replacing entire carpets. By opting for patching, homeowners can maintain the aesthetic and comfort of their spaces while addressing issues quickly and efficiently. The process can also help prevent further deterioration, extending the life of the existing carpet.

The overview below groups typical Carpet Patching proj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- For minor patching on small areas,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, especially for straightforward repairs to small sections of carpet.

Medium-Sized Patching - Larger patches or repairs on moderate areas generally cost between $600 and $1,200. These projects are common for damaged sections that require more extensive work but are still manageable in scope.

Large Repairs - Extensive patching on larger sections or multiple areas can range from $1,200 to $3,000. Fewer projects reach into this tier, often involving more complex or multiple repairs across a space.

Full Carpet Replacement - Complete replacement of a carpet can cost $2,000 to $5,000 or more, depending on the size and material. Larger, more complex projects tend to push into the higher end of this range, while smaller spaces typically fall below it.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is carpet patching? Carpet patching is a repair process that involves replacing a damaged or stained section of carpet with a matching piece to restore its appearance.

Can carpet patching be done on any type of carpet? Most types of carpets, including plush, Berber, and loop, can be repaired with patching, but the suitability depends on the specific material and condition.

How do local contractors match the carpet color and pattern? Experienced service providers use existing carpet pieces or samples to ensure a close color and pattern match during the patching process.

Is carpet patching a permanent solution? When performed properly, carpet patching can be a durable repair that blends seamlessly with the surrounding area.

How do service providers prepare for a carpet patching job? Local contractors typically assess the damage, select an appropriate matching piece, and carefully cut and install the patch for a seamless look.
